Output e14138d92d3de36bb4f72665afff8723534c0a9f07aac11d54a54344073c6489:0

value
511247542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43c93edffb2de01a1c57d372b116a61a31305286 OP_EQUALVERIFY OP_CHECKSIG
address
17BRMeG72SwuDm5Va5W1gCDBEuaUVz4iYf
transaction
e14138d92d3de36bb4f72665afff8723534c0a9f07aac11d54a54344073c6489
spent
true